Job description

The Catering Department, Victoria Hospital, Blackpool are looking for a Chef to be part of the busy team. If you are a dynamic person who can raise to the challenges of providing a fresh cook service to over 800 patients per meal service and over 500 restaurant customers per day please read on.

The Chef holds a very important role in food production and meal services that contributes to patients being treated and being given higher quality of care. They undertake a key role in the day-to-day food production, responsible for food service standards in the production of meals and food safety standards. They ensure a high quality, cost effective and resourceful service delivery and that food is nutritious and appetising. They must meet patients' medical and cultural needs including, for example, gluten free, low fat, soft food, halal and vegetarian meals.

They must be open to applying a partnership approach and to embrace new ways of working which best deliver the range and quality of service required to meet the needs of patients and customers, in as efficient and effective a way as possible.

If successful you will be part of a brigade of chefs carrying out day-to-day operational requirements for our traditional cook food services to patients, staff and visitors. You will ensure a high quality, fresh cook service delivery, following our standardised recipes

The main duties include operating from one central kitchen with modern production systems are applied in the 'Conventional Cook-Serve Method' of preparation of meals for patients and staff together with maintaining high standards of cleanliness of equipment and premises. All work to be undertaken in line with Trust Food Safety Policy & Procedures.

The shift patters cover early, middle and late shift ranging from 6am to 7pm on a rota basis including some weekends and bank holidays.

Preparing, cooking and serving of all types of foods that are nutritious and appetising and meets patients' medical and cultural needs including, for example special dietary needs, gluten free, low fat, soft food, halal and vegetarian in accordance with Quality Standards, Standardised Recipes and Food Safety controls.

Using commodity supplies and ingredients in correct proportions and stock control rotation and being attentive to accuracy in the preparation, production and issue of all food items, with particular care given to consistent quality and portion control.

Completing all associated HACCP (Hazard Analysis Critical Control Points) documentation. Ensuring that all food items needing refrigeration are stored without delay as per Food Safety policy

Minimising waste through economical and correct use of all materials.
